Advice on how to buy health insurance intelligently.

Cheap health insurance is still available it has not gone the way of the nickel soda or the 10 cent candy bar. As with anything in life, information is power (you have to know where to look) and a little bit of hard work will go a long way (albeit a little bit of smarts along with hard work will go even farther).

So, let’s get down to it. Here are 3 things to do now (estimated time: 15 minutes) that if you actually do them could end up saving you $50, $100, or even more every month on you health insurance bill. If you would care to save $600, $1,200, or more over the next 12 months and use that money to go out to eat or go on vacation rather than giving it away to a large insurance company in extra premiums then start your 15 minute timer!

1. Evaluate your plan deductible carefully. It must be a high deductible. You should NOT expect to reach your deductible except once in every 10-years.
2. Find an insurance company that sells Health Savings Account type plans, called High Deductible Health Plans.
3. Make sure you understand the plan. Your agent should be able to answer all your questions. Go ahead and switch to that plan and save money each month.
